The reflection of light is simplified when light is treated as a ray. This concept is illustrated in Figure 16.3, which also shows how the angles are measured relative to the line perpendicular to the surface at the point where the light ray strikes it. This perpendicular line is also called the normal line, or just the normal.

Reflection is when light bounces off an object. If the surface is smooth and shiny, like glass, water or polished metal, the light will reflect at the same angle as it hit the surface. This is called specular reflection. Diffuse reflection is when light hits an object and reflects in lots of different directions. This happens when the surface.

Definition: The Law of Reflection The angle at which a ray of light is incident on a surface is equal to the angle at which it is reflected, and on the opposite side of the normal. Mathematically, if the angle of incidence is 𝜃 and the angle of reflection is 𝜃 , then 𝜃 = 𝜃.
